What is the PSMA Marker?

The psma marker, or prostate-specific membrane antigen, is a protein on prostate cancer cells. It’s like a biological beacon that shows where disease is in the body.

This protein is mostly found on cancer cells, not healthy ones. So, psma imaging uses it to create a clear map of cancer’s location.”Precision medicine is not just about better technology; it is about finding the right target to ensure every patient receives the most accurate diagnosis possible.”

How PSMA PET/CT Differs from Conventional Scans

Older scans look at how cells use glucose to find tumors. But, they can confuse inflammation with cancer.

psma pet ct is different. It directly targets cancer cells. This method has big benefits for your care:

  • Higher Sensitivity: It finds smaller cancer cells that other scans might miss.
  • Improved Specificity: It’s less likely to mistake healthy tissue for disease.
  • Better Staging: It gives a full view of the disease, helping plan your treatment.

Choosing psma pet imaging lets us see your condition’s specific biology. This pet/ct prostate method gives us the best data. It helps us offer you a more personalized and effective treatment plan.

Comparing Accuracy Rates: PSMA PET/CT vs. Conventional Imaging

New studies show a big change in how we see diseases. Prostate cancer pet ct tech beats old methods like bone scans and CT scans. It’s about 27% more accurate.

Old methods can spot disease in about 65% of cases. But psma pet/ct scans can hit 92% accuracy. This means we can find small problems that might be missed. Precision is our goal for your recovery.

Sensitivity and Specificity in Initial Detection and Staging

A psma scan for prostate cancer offers top-notch diagnostic standards. It’s 97% sensitive for first detection. This means we rarely miss disease, even at low PSA levels.

Though specificity is 66%, these numbers together help with staging. We use this info to make your care plan as precise as possible from the start. Here’s how these methods compare in real-world use.

What can I expect during my PSMA PET CT scan appointment?

During a PSMA PET CT scan, a small amount of tracer is given. After a short wait, detailed images of your body are taken. The whole process is non-invasive and gives our specialists a full view of your health.

Can a PET/CT prostate scan detect cancer that has spread to the bones or lymph nodes?

Yes, PET/CT prostate imaging is great at finding cancer spread. Unlike standard scans, PSMA imaging’s high sensitivity lets us see cancer in distant sites like bones or lymph nodes, even when they’re small. This detail is key for managing cancer long-term.
